Arsenal Stuns Real Madrid with Declan Rice’s Free-Kick ‍Masterclass in Champions League

Gunners Dominate first Leg, Putting one Foot in Semi-Finals

LONDON – Arsenal ⁤delivered a stunning performance, defeating Real Madrid 3-0‌ in the⁣ first leg of their Champions League quarter-final clash, ⁣thanks to a brace ⁤of sensational free-kicks from Declan Rice.

Rice’s Brilliance Leads⁤ Arsenal to Commanding Victory

The English midfielder opened ‍the scoring in the 58th minute with a stunning ​set-piece, before adding a second just⁢ 12 minutes​ later. Mikel Merino then grabbed a third, ⁣sending​ the Emirates Stadium into⁣ a frenzy and putting Arsenal⁤ in a commanding position‍ ahead of the return leg at the Bernabeu.

Arteta’s belief ⁣Justified in Dominant Display

Prior to the match, Arsenal manager Mikel Arteta expressed his ​belief that his team could defeat the 15-time European champions and create their own history. His confidence was vindicated on a night where Arsenal dominated, ‍showcasing a performance that could be remembered as one of the club’s finest in ⁢European competition.

Saka’s⁢ Return Proves Pivotal

Bukayo Saka, making his first start in 108 days following hamstring surgery, played a key role in arsenal’s ⁤success, ‌winning both free-kicks that Rice converted with such expertise.

Early exchanges See Arsenal Overcome Initial Threat

Despite ⁢Real Madrid’s⁢ pedigree, Arsenal⁢ quickly ⁣asserted their dominance. An early chance for Kylian Mbappe was thwarted by Arsenal goalkeeper David Raya, before Arsenal responded with several dangerous attacks.

Goalless First Half Belies Arsenal’s Pressure

Arsenal registered four shots ⁤on target in the first half,​ the‌ most they have ever had in the first 45 minutes of a champions League knockout game without scoring. Despite the pressure, the first half ended ⁣goalless.

Second-Half blitz secures Decisive⁣ Advantage

Arsenal’s persistence paid off‍ in the second half. Saka⁤ continued to trouble the Real Madrid defense,⁢ winning a free-kick which Rice curled expertly into the net, past a helpless‍ Thibaut Courtois.

Arsenal ‌continued to press, with Martinelli and Merino going close before Rice scored his ‌second free-kick, an even more impressive effort that left Courtois with no chance.

Merino Seals Emphatic Win

Teenage midfielder Lewis-Skelly then ⁢set⁢ up Merino, who finished with precision to make it 3-0, sparking ‍wild celebrations and putting Arsenal ⁢firmly in control of the tie.
